diff options
Diffstat (limited to 'examples/pdf-split-pages.cc')
-rw-r--r-- | examples/pdf-split-pages.cc |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/examples/pdf-split-pages.cc b/examples/pdf-split-pages.cc index b6dd701b..7857d649 100644 --- a/examples/pdf-split-pages.cc +++ b/examples/pdf-split-pages.cc @@ -8,6 +8,7 @@ #include <qpdf/QPDFPageDocumentHelper.hh> #include <qpdf/QPDFWriter.hh> #include <qpdf/QUtil.hh> +#include <qpdf/QIntC.hh> #include <iostream> #include <stdlib.h> @@ -24,7 +25,8 @@ static void process(char const* whoami, inpdf.processFile(infile); std::vector<QPDFPageObjectHelper> pages = QPDFPageDocumentHelper(inpdf).getAllPages(); - int pageno_len = QUtil::int_to_string(pages.size()).length(); + int pageno_len = + QIntC::to_int(QUtil::uint_to_string(pages.size()).length()); int pageno = 0; for (std::vector<QPDFPageObjectHelper>::iterator iter = pages.begin(); iter != pages.end(); ++iter) |